Ne arayalım?

ARAMIZA KATILIN

BİZE ULAŞIN

Adres:

E-posta:

host/bin/bilisimlife.dll

iletisim@bilisimlife.net




 
Rserit
Developer
       
 1029  
 278

Cannot deserialize the JSON array (e.g. [1,2,3]) into type Hatası

Selamlar,
JSON bir veriyi deserialize ederken "Cannot deserialize the JSON array (e.g. [1,2,3]) into type ' ' because type requires JSON object (e.g. { name: value}) to deserialize correctly" gibi bir hatayla karşılaşıyorsanız, sorun JSON tarafındaki bir türün, deserialize edeceğiniz sınıfla uyumsuzluğundan ötürüdür. Böyle durumlarda JSON örneğiniz ya da nasıl class kullandığınıza bakmak gerekiyor ancak hata genellikle List kullanımından / kullanmadığınızdan ötürü olur.

Böyle denemelisiniz:JsonConvert.DeserializeObject>(JsonStr);
JSON tarafından List dönmüyorsa:JsonConvert.DeserializeObject(JsonStr);

İyi çalışmalar,
Recep.


Bu gönderiyi 07.11.2018 11:39:51 tarihinde Rserit düzenledi.

Developer.